Harnessing Neuroplasticity for Improved Fluency
Neuroplasticity, the brain’s ability to reorganize itself by forming new neural connections, is a cornerstone of this programme. Therapists learn how to harness this natural process to facilitate healing and relearning in the brain. Techniques such as neurofeedback, which involves monitoring brain activity and providing real-time feedback, are explored as powerful tools for promoting neural changes.

Integrating Cutting-Edge Technologies in Therapy
The programme also emphasizes the integration of emerging technologies into speech therapy. Technologies such as virtual reality (VR) and artificial intelligence (AI) are being used to create immersive and interactive therapeutic environments. These tools not only make the therapy process more engaging but also provide therapists with valuable data to monitor and adjust treatment plans in real-time.
